## Hermetic Build Migration

We are moving the Larkspur service from ad-hoc Make targets to the Quillstone hermetic build system. All dependencies are now pinned in the lockfile; do not install toolchains on the host. If a build fails during your on-call shift, rerun with the sandbox flag before escalating. Cache uploads to the Fennel artifact store require authentication, and the key is scoped to read-write on the build cache only. Use the credential below when configuring the cache client.

API key for yahig-tadup: kto7_ubizbYm

# Environments: PinPoint Autocomplete

Three environments: dev, staging, prod. Dev resets nightly. Staging mirrors prod data minus the Harwick dataset. Promotions go dev → staging → prod; no direct prod pushes. Staging smoke tests must pass before release sign-off. Prod config is locked behind change review. Current staging values are as follows.

settings of kafop-fahog:
PRAWYN_PIN=8793
PRAWYN_METRICS_HOST=metrics.prawyn.lumiccorp.corp
PRAWYN_LOG_LEVEL=warn
PRAWYN_TENANT=kasox

Ticket: SPRIG-482 — Expired credentials for GreenMinder scheduler

The GreenMinder plant-watering scheduler stopped dispatching jobs Tuesday night because its credential for the internal ValveHub API lapsed. No plants were harmed; manual watering covered the gap. Rotation cadence should move to 90 days. For the sync: the replacement credential has been issued and is below.

gateway credential: kto3_qfe

Key ceremony item #7 — TileFerret prefetcher signing key. Plugin authors, heads up: once we rotate this key, any prefetch manifests you publish must be re-signed or the Wrenmoor CDN will refuse them. During the ceremony we also seal the fallback credential used to recover the signing vault if the HSM card dies. Jot down the recovery passphrase shown immediately below.

unlock words, hafop-tahog: drumir-druiel-kasox-wenax-tamys-frair